Transportation / Supply Chains
Modern transportation and supply chains operate on razor-thin margins of time and reliability.
Ports, airports, rail terminals, logistics hubs, warehouses, and cold-storage facilities now depend on uninterrupted power for safety systems, automation, communications, inventory management, and real-time data exchange.
Yet grid infrastructure across many logistics corridors remains fragile, congested, and increasingly vulnerable to climate events, cyber disruption, and geopolitical risk.
Nearly 89% of global executives reported experiencing energy-related supply chain disruptions in 2025 and 83% believe power reliability will drive the next major supply chain crisis.

Insurance / Disaster Recovery
The frequency and severity of extreme weather and infrastructure failures are escalating what was once an operational inconvenience into a systemic business risk with real financial consequences. In the United States alone, there were 23 separate billion-dollar weather and climate disasters in 2025 — collectively driving over $115 billion in damages across sectors.
For insurers and risk managers, the economic impact of prolonged power outages extends far beyond physical asset damage — encompassing business interruption, supply chain disruption, inventory loss, and contingent liabilities. Many models still fail to capture these growing exposures, leaving resilience investments undervalued in pricing and underwriting frameworks.
